Cannondale V700 Rear Shock
HI, I have a 1997 Cannondale V700 and the rear shock (Fox Alps 5R) is dead. I live in Argentina so it's very expensive to send you the old shock for repair. Is there any brand new Fox shock (2014 catalogue) that I could use to replace mine?
Many thanks. Ramiro

I recommend contacting Risse Racing, who still make replacement air shocks for a lot of the older bikes, including Pro-Flex bikes and others that use the clevis-mounting setup as on some of these old Cannondales.
Risse seems to have very good pricing, but I don't know if you could rebuild their shock at home or not.
